About This Item
Wiedenfeld & Nicolson 1952 . Hardback Red cloth cvoers with slight fading on spine. Book leans slightly. Dustwrapper has wear and small tears at edges with fading on spine. Illustrated with 8 plates by Leonard Rosoman. 101 pages A story about the underworld of Paris prostitutes. Wt 0.5 kg Good (Poor)
